Hexacyano complexes of iron in the oxidation states II and III, as well as cyanide complexes containing both irons, are known. [Hexacyanoferrate(II)] Chemical formula: H 4 [Fe(CN) 6 ]. Commonly known as ferrocyanic acid. When concentrated hydrochloric acid is added to an aqueous solution of potassium ferricyanide (II), cooled, and ether is added, an ether adduct is obtained, which is then heated to 80-90°C in a dry hydrogen stream to obtain ferrocyanic acid. Colorless crystalline powder. Relatively stable in dry air. Decomposes when exposed to moisture, heat, or light, gradually turning green.
